Music students visit the Royal Festival Hall

In the autumn term a group of music students attended a Sunday concert at the Royal Festival Hall given by the Philharmonia Orchestra and its ebullient conductor Leif Segerstam. We spent some time on the South Bank as the weather was so nice before going inside to enjoy the concert. The highlight was Mussorgsky's Pictures at an Exhibition. The final section was called 'The Great Gate of Kiev'  which year 9 percussionist Peter Bell described as "amazing" as the combined forces of huge cymbals and booming timpani drums drove the piece to its thunderous conclusion!
